Catchings Nominated for ESPY

June 27, 2013

ESPN announced Thursday that Indiana Fever star Tamika Catchings has been nominated for the 2013 ESPY for Best WNBA Player. Catchings was the 2012 WNBA Finals MVP after leading the Fever to its first-ever WNBA Championship. The other nominees are Tina Charles (Connecticut Sun), Angel McCoughtry (Atlanta Dream), Candace Parker (Los Angeles Sparks), and Lindsay Whalen (Minnesota Lynx).

Fans will determine the winners for Best WNBA Player and all other ESPY awards by voting online at ESPN.com/ESPYS. Voting is underway and will continue until the live show starts Wednesday, July 17, at 9 PM EDT. The live broadcast of the 2013 ESPYS will air on ESPN and ESPNHD.

Below is the list of nominees for Best WNBA Player and their credentials:

Tamika Catchings, Indiana Fever: Led the Fever to its first WNBA championship, WNBA Finals MVP

Tina Charles, Connecticut Sun: Led WNBA in rebounding during regular season (10.5 rpg.), Fifth in scoring at 18.0 ppg, Captured her third straight rebounding title

Angel McCoughtry, Atlanta Dream: � Led WNBA in scoring during regular season (21.4 ppg), Averaged more than 20 points per game for the third straight year

Candace Parker, Los Angeles Sparks: Averaged 17.4 ppg during 2012 regular season, Averaged 9.7 rpg

Lindsay Whalen, Minnesota Lynx: Led the WNBA in assists during regular season (5.39 apg.), Dished out five or more assists in 22 games
